Roland DGA to Showcase its Latest UV and Direct-to-Garment Printing Technologies in Adobe MAX 2020 Online Conference

Wide-format digital imaging leader Roland DGA Corporation, a Gold Sponsor of the Adobe MAX 2020 Creativity Conference taking place October 20-22, will showcase its latest UV printing and direct-to-garment printing technologies at this free-to-attend, high-profile online event.  

Roland DGA will be supplying digital design templates and VersaUV printers for use in an Adobe MAX 2020 pre-conference workshop – “MAX-I-MUM WARP” – to be led by Adobe Senior Creative Director, Russell Brown.  In addition, Roland DGA will be providing an informative video tutorial on the new VersaSTUDIO BT-12 direct-to-garment printer – an affordable desktop device that makes printing full-color designs directly to apparel and accessories easier than ever. 

Pre-conference workshop attendees will have their own graphic designs printed onto customized plastic face shields with the Roland DG VersaUV LEF2 series UV flatbed printer. Uniquely engineered for product customization and personalization, LEF2 flatbeds are compact UV-LED printers that print directly on a vast array of substrates and three-dimensional objects with ease and precision.   

Those attending the Adobe MAX 2020 online conference can view Roland DGA’s video tutorial on the VersaSTUDIO BT-12, hosted by Roland DGA end user Laura Sims, who uses her BT-12 to create decorated apparel she sells through her online retail business, Wendy and Wander (www.wendyandwander.com).

Roland DGA will also be providing product prizes for several contests and giveaways planned for Adobe MAX 2020.  The company will supply 200 zipper pouches custom-printed with a BT-12 for the “MAX Giveaway,” as well as a big prize for one lucky winner of the “MAX Game” – a new BT-12 direct-to-garment printer package, valued at over $5,000.
